BACE offers a comprehensive, hands-on
childbirth instructor certification program along with advanced
childbirth training workshops (current
workshops
). We
train and certify instructors in an integrated and individualized
approach that ensures childbearing families have the skills,
information and support they need. In addition, BACE provides referrals
to qualified childbirth instructors and other perinatal services and
care providers in the area.
The Nursing Mothers' Council (NMC) was
founded as an integral part of BACE in 1962. Its primary mission is to
offer support and information to women who wish to breastfeed their
babies. NMC trains lay counselors in breastfeeding management and
counseling skills (current workshops
) and publishes a list
of counselors that is distributed to area hospitals and healthcare providers.
Anyone who wishes to speak to a counselor, free
of charge, can refer to the list or call
our office for a referral. NMC also provides advanced training for lactation
professionals and for those preparing to take the certifying
exam given by the International Board of Lactation Consultant
Examiners (IBLCE
).
BACE is a non-profit organization that is supported
solely by membership dues, contributions, income from professional trainings
and revenue from the sale
and rental of breastfeeding aids. Most of the work of the organization is done
on a volunteer basis. BACE is governed by a board
of directors made up of members who represent both
the childbirth education and breastfeeding programs. The board
meets bimonthly from September to May and has an
annual meeting in June. New members are always welcome!
